About CCIAP

The Canadian Coalition for Immunization Awareness & Promotion (CCIAP) is a partnership of national non-governmental, professional, health, consumer, government and private sector organizations with a specific interest in promoting the understanding and use of vaccines recommended by the National Advisory Committee on Immunization.

The goal of the CCIAP is to contribute to the control/elimination/eradication of vaccine-preventable diseases in Canada by increasing awareness of the benefits and risks of immunization for all ages via education, promotion, advocacy and media relations.

The CCIAP is the result of the merger, in January 2004, of the Canadian Immunization Awareness Program (CIAP) and the Canadian Coalition for Influenza Immunization (CCII). CCII began as "Flu Alert ©" under the Lung Association of Canada, before expanding over the years and eventually merging with CIAP.

Funding for the CCIAP and its activities is derived from:
  • In-kind contributions from the member organizations
  • Charitable donations to the Canadian Public Health Association
  • Publication sales
  • Contracts with the Public Health Agency of Canada
  • Unrestricted educational grants from Abbott Canada Inc., GlaxoSmithKline Canada, Merck Frosst Canada, Novartis Pharmaceuticals Canada Inc., Pfizer Canada, and sanofi pasteur Canada.
